This is a bougainvillea that I really liked the trunk on, it's thick and has those large, funky knots on either side of its base - problem is that there's like ~10 shoots on it and I just cannot imagine what direction to take it... so far my best idea is to simply remove *every* shoot except for the ones on the top ~1" of the trunk, so all the growth gets directed there, and have a thick top on that trunk (maybe leave the growth on the side-trunk, keep cutting it back so it's eventually just a tiny, single pad that's very dense/ramified)

I'm planning to do...whatever ends up getting done!....in early spring, as soon as I see growth start picking up - any suggestions at all on how to handle this less-than-stellar stock would be greatly appreciated! :)
